Napolitano Bringing Heat on Obama

ILLEGAL iMMIGRANT NYT AUG 4 Silver Spring A Sunday feature in the Washington Post had Obama rating his initial chances at election as 25-30%.  He was wrong then, but he could be right now about re-election if he continues to alienate the burgeoning Hispanic base that was key to his victory.  A professor in today’s Times called the situation for immigrants the “worst of both worlds,” meaning that immigrants were facing escalating enforcement with no concrete prospects for reform.

The front page article on the Times was based on the virtually below the radar actions, which they labeled “small” butsignificant by immigrant reform advocates in Los Angeles and New York City targeting Homeland Security andtherefore immigration chief copy, Janet Napolitano, as the problem.  She danced around the issue of Arpaio in the Times, by pretending that the 287g subcontracted immigration enforcement to cities and counties might be too onerous for the Sheriff, who has publicly just scoffed at them thus far.

More devastating as a time bomb for the President and Napolitano might be the eruption of hunger strikes in a private prison in Louisiana that holds detainees who have been swept up in the immigrant bashing.  Reports from the Saket Soni, director of the New Orleans Workers’ Center for Racial Justice as covered by Chris Kromm at the Institute for Southern Studies, hit the wire services and elsewhere this week about the sub-human conditions being allowed detainees in these private Homeland Security compounds.

I was shocked to read about Guantanamo conditions existing in Louisiana.

The lack of progress on reform and the steady tightening of the screws on immigrants that is now being allowed and encouraged by the Administration is no longer a well kept secret, and will not long be something that the Secretary can keep from bringing the President down unless there is action on all fronts now.

These kinds of reports will guarantee that the response will not be “small” for long!
